This is yet another "here watch an internet video so I can try to make funny comments about it" show. It's not that it isn't funny, but how hard can it really be to base everything off of videos you show? Just like RayWilliamJohnson on YouTube, but he doesn't get paid for it and isn't on an actual network. The "here's a clip -insert 'funny' comment here-" shows just annoy me. Maybe it's just me who thinks it doesn't take any kind of talent at all to stand there and comment on videos.
Whatever parts of Tosh.O you do remember are the videos that you go to look up after the show. His comments aren't nearly as funny as the clips he shows. One segment of the show is "Web Redemption" in which he gets someone who made a fool of themselves and put the video on the internet and he brings them there to make fun of them. This is just annoying. As if they haven't had enough people making fun of them because of something that got caught on video, now national television gets to see them even more humiliated. Then there's how he uses half the show to make fun of certain races and/or genders for stupid stereotypes that are way overused in the first place. I know there was some other show exactly like this on Comedy Central before (at least I think it was Comedy Central) and I don't know what happened to it. Maybe it horribly failed just like I expect Tosh.O to in the pretty near future. Personally I'd rather watch RayWilliamJohnson because it's easier to find the videos after you watch his video. Even though both Tosh and Johnson annoy me, I would only watch them to find funny videos.
I give it: 5/10
